Experience the uplifting gift of Gale Jones Murphy's setting of the Beatitudes in this new offering from the Brandon A. Boyd Choral Series. Inspired by scripture, this anthem celebrates spiritual wealth and eternal promise over worldly values. Featuring an energetic gospel style, it transitions from unison to a rhythmic "bounce," as described by the composer, and builds to rich harmonies that captivate singers and listeners alike. About the Composer: Gale Jones Murphy

Gale Jones Murphy is a composer and arranger whose work centers on sacred and spiritual music, particularly settings that blend traditional choral writing with contemporary styles. Her compositions are known for their accessibility without sacrificing musical depth, making them valuable resources for church choirs, community ensembles, and educational programs seeking repertoire with emotional resonance.

How to get the most out of it

  • Establish the unison section with clean diction and a settled tempo before the rhythmic energy enters. The contrast will land harder when it arrives.
  • Lean into the gospel style vocabulary without forcing it. Let the natural swing emerge from the rhythmic notation rather than overlaying a separate groove.
  • Shape the final harmonic build with strategic dynamics. Each new layer should feel like a conscious deepening, not just volume for its own sake.
  • Have your ensemble listen to the recorded accompaniment multiple times during rehearsal, paying particular attention to how the groove sits in relation to the harmonic rhythm.

Skills your students will build

  • Gospel style articulation and phrasing conventions
  • Singing unison passages with focused tone before transitioning to divisi writing
  • Maintaining rhythmic precision in syncopated passages
  • Balancing individual voice parts while contributing to harmonic density
  • Building and sustaining musical momentum through structural changes
